Revenge is My Love Language novel Chapter 357

“Why are you staring at me like that, darling?” Anastasia pouted playfully as she darted over to him.

She added, “Did Aaron and his parents show up?”

Harrison’s lips had just begun to curl into a smile at her first question, but at the mention of Aaron, the fleeting warmth vanished.

“Are you worried about him?” he asked, tone a little too even.

He couldn’t stand hearing another man’s name on her lips—especially not Aaron, the man she’d once been involved with.

“I was just asking,” Anastasia said quickly when she noticed his displeasure. She scooted closer, trying to soothe him. “I bet they’re here to beg for your help. As long as you’re willing to back them up, they won’t have to worry about the West family’s retaliation.”

“Is that what you want, Ana? For me to stand up for them?” With a possessive arm, Harrison pulled her into his lap, holding her securely against him as if it were the most natural thing in the world.

“Why should you help them?” Anastasia retorted without thinking, giving a soft, dismissive snort. “They’re only getting what they deserve.”

He glanced down, catching the obvious distaste and hint of mischief in her expression. Whatever annoyance he’d felt faded completely. He pressed a light kiss to the corner of her mouth. “Alright. We’ll do it your way.”

He looked up and called to Logan, “You heard what my wife said. Show them out.”

Logan nodded, turning to leave, though he couldn’t help but mutter privately. As if Mr. Harrison Lancaster would ever actually help the Aaron family, even if Mrs. Lancaster asked him to. If anything, he’d probably prefer to see them wiped from the face of the earth.

At the gates of Rosewood Manor—

“What? How could Mr. Harrison Lancaster refuse to see us? Aaron’s his nephew! Is he really just going to turn his back on us?”

“Logan, please! Just speak to him for us one more time!” Debby pleaded, frantic.

The three of them fell silent. Aaron, listless and withdrawn, hadn’t said a word.

“No.” Debby’s voice trembled with determination. “We still have one option left.”

Barry looked at her, incredulous. “After all this, what could we possibly do?”

Debby suppressed her anger, eyes narrowing. “Anastasia… she used to be in love with our Aaron, didn’t she?”

As soon as she said it, husband and wife exchanged a glance. The same idea flashed in their eyes, and they turned in unison to look at their son.

Aaron, who had been in a daze the entire time, suddenly seemed to wake up. A strange glint flickered in his eyes as he realized what his parents meant.
